A West Palm Beach woman and her two children were killed on Sunday when the airplane in which they were riding crashed in a south Georgia peanut field.

The pilot, Joe Townsend, 38, also of West Palm Beach, was in critical condition late Monday after undergoing surgery at Phoebe Putney Hospital in Albany, Ga., a nursing supervisor said. The names of the three dead passengers were not known on Monday.

The four-seater plane crashed about 300 yards from the Fitzgerald Municipal Airport runway, authorities said.

The cause of the crash had not been determined. Weather conditions at the time of the crash included heavy rain, gusting winds and a significant drop in temperature, the National Transportation Safety Board said.
